Transaction 5cc39a9683f66b9ced2abd73cad0bf52c56f060d8b847da139a01cca26c96740
1 Input
1 Output
-
5cc39a9683f66b9ced2abd73cad0bf52c56f060d8b847da139a01cca26c96740:0
- value
- 3692798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ebf8a9772b1060929345f002132e15f76e607ca3 OP_EQUAL
- address
- 3PCibxgMRpGXcjMB1tTg8REnLFU7MKEDUy